Output d614287142e15080580e05d1a5332a4e9b51a04014527bea20fd705af7306c5e:0

value
63508198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e03150733a561144d37854a245712583e58a6658 OP_EQUAL
address
3N8SMvoj1F7HH7mPtWpEU9KTGqZhMrSGWD
transaction
d614287142e15080580e05d1a5332a4e9b51a04014527bea20fd705af7306c5e
confirmations
307303
spent
true